On Wed, 18 Nov 1998, Anthony Lemons wrote:
> Anyone know if there is a HOW-TO on increasing the filedescriptors from the
> default 256? Running RH 5.0 and 5.1.
the "ulimit" incantation seems to exist on my 5.2 install,
and I use it under Solaris to control the number of file
descriptors available to a process. There's no man page
here though, and the "usage" message is terse.
